Structures of TRAFs. (a) Domain organizations. (b) Crystal structure of the dimeric RING and ZF domains (ZF1-3) of TRAF6. (c) Crystal structure of the dimeric RING and ZF domain (ZF1) of TRAF2. (d) Crystal structure of TRAF6 RING and ZF domain (ZF1) in complex with Ubc13. (e) Crystal structure of TRAF2 CC in complex with cIAP2 BIR1 domain. (f, g) Crystal structure of the TRAF domain of TRAF2 in complex with a peptide from the CD40 receptor in space-filling and ribbon diagrams, respectively. (h, i) Crystal structure of the TRAF domain of TRAF2 in complex with the NTD of TRADD in space-filling and ribbon diagrams, respectively. (j) An infinite aggregation model of full-length TRAF proteins by alternating dimerization and trimerization. Abbreviations: CC, coiled coil; NTD, N-terminal domain; TRAF, tumor necrosis factor (TNF) receptor–associated factor.
